Transaction 95f2d975cfb78326a4a270898959292ac33a10e08b995fe54a16df7e80d00351
1 Input
2 Outputs
- 95f2d975cfb78326a4a270898959292ac33a10e08b995fe54a16df7e80d00351:0
- 95f2d975cfb78326a4a270898959292ac33a10e08b995fe54a16df7e80d00351:1
value 1259481850
address 1MDPTWCepVtYi6SxrhAzjV1gH5xMHpZ4ax
value 699000
address 164bc9cTGRBr9eikRU36TWb5CF7jcBv2FW